Calling an evil genius dumb or trying to bully them is a really bad idea. Especially when said evil genius has an equally evil and equally genius boyfriend. Warnings for bullying & violence.
***
“You’re a little bitch, aren’t you, Hanamiya-kun?” Her voice rang out so loudly that even Imayoshi, who’d been walking out and was just outside the classroom door, could hear her clearly. “Cozying up to the upperclassmen like that. He must think you’re a real drag.”
The harsh accent immediately identified her as the new exchange student but Imayoshi would’ve guessed that anyway. Nobody else would be stupid enough to pick on Hanamiya.
Hanamiya’s laughter echoed through the suddenly-quiet room. “Imayoshi-senpai? And how do you know him well enough to know what he thinks of me?”
“I know boys like you from my school.”
Imayoshi shifted a little so he could see the slim, brown-haired girl who had her hands on her hips as she continued, “You’re nothing but little brown nosers. You suck up to the upperclassmen because nobody in your grade likes you.”
Had it been a few months ago, before Hanamiya had revealed his real self, the class would have been full of protests from students who thought that Hanamiya was the best person ever. Now, however, the silence of the room was that of a crowd waiting for the guillotine to fall.
“You’d know all about being disliked, Haruko-chan,” Hanamiya said almost lazily, as if she weren’t worth the effort of being angry. “You play the victim and accuse people so that people will feel sorry for you to hide the fact there’s nothing about you that’s worth liking. Did you sign up for the exchange program because everyone at your old school hated you too?”
Haruko raised her hands to her face, sobbing into them dramatically and loudly. “You’re so mean! I’m going to tell the teacher on you!”
“Go ahead,” Hanamiya said with that same cool indifference. “Everyone heard you call me a bitch.”
And while they might not like Hanamiya, they knew better than to cross him by lying about who had started it.
Imayoshi pushed the door open and sauntered in, giving Haruko a brief, incurious look. “Hanamiya - the others want to know if you’ll join us for lunch.”
Hanamiya smiled up at him from his desk, eyes crinkling in amusement. “Of course, senpai. I’m always happy for some intelligent conversation.”
As if annoyed that her hysterics were going ignored, Haruko cried even harder.
Imayoshi gave a little wave to Hanamiya and left the room. Hanamiya could deal with her himself.
*
Three days later, Haruko fell down the stairs and broke her arm.
Nobody signed her cast.
